Item-total Correlation
The relationship between individual item scores and the overall score across all items in a test or questionnaire.
Split-half Reliability
An evaluation of reliability involving splitting a test into two sections and comparing scores from each section to check how consistent the test is.
Cohen's Kappa
A statistical coefficient that measures inter-rater agreement for qualitative (categorical) items.
Interrater Reliability
Refers to the degree of agreement among independent observers or raters evaluating the same phenomenon.
